diff --git a/.github/workflows/gradle.yml b/.github/workflows/gradle.yml index b3010c2..6fd1186 100644 --- a/.github/workflows/gradle.yml +++ b/.github/workflows/gradle.yml @@ -3,33 +3,31 @@ name: Java CI with Gradle on: push: branches: [ master ] + pull_request: + branches: [ master ] + workflow_dispatch: j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v2 - - name: Set up JDK 15 - uses: actions/setup-java@v1 - with: - java-version: 15 - - name: Setup Android SDK Tools - uses: android-actions/setup-android@v2.0.1 - env: - ACTIONS_ALLOW_UNSECURE_COMMANDS: 'true' - - name: build-tools - run: sdkmanager "build-tools;29.0.3" - - name: Add Android SDK to PATH - run: echo "${ANDROID_HOME}/build-tools/29.0.3" >> $GITHUB_PATH + - uses: actions/checkout@v2 + - name: Set up JDK 16 + uses: actions/setup-java@v1 + with: + java-version: 16 + - name: Setup Android SDK Tools + uses: android-actions/setup-android@v2.0.1 + env: + ACTIONS_ALLOW_UNSECURE_COMMANDS: 'true' + - name: build-tools + run: sdkmanager "build-tools;29.0.3" + - name: Add Android SDK to PATH + run: echo "${ANDROID_HOME}/build-tools/29.0.3" >> $GITHUB_PATH - - name: Grant execute permission for gradlew - run: chmod +x gradlew - - name: Build with Gradle - run: ./gradlew buildDex - - - name: Upload a Build Artifact (dexed) - uses: actions/upload-artifact@v2.2.1 - with: - name: dexed - path: build/libs/raw-*.jar + - name: Upload Build Artifact + uses: actions/upload-artifact@v2.2.1 + with: + name: informatis + path: build/libs/[!raw-]*.jar